公司概述
TaskUs, Inc. operates within the technology sector, specifically providing outsourced digital services for companies across the Philippines, the United States, India, and international markets, with a primary focus on omni-channel customer care delivered through non-voice digital channels. The company is categorized under the Information Technology Services industry, which signifies its role as a specialized provider of external technological capabilities rather than a pure software developer or hardware manufacturer. In terms of scale, TaskUs boasts a market capitalization of $602.23 million and generates annual revenue of $1.18 billion, employing a workforce of 65,500 individuals. These financial metrics indicate that TaskUs has established a significant operational footprint, leveraging a substantial employee base to deliver services that generate over a billion dollars in revenue, positioning it as a mid-to-large-cap entity within the global BPO landscape.
财务健康
The company reported a trailing twelve-month revenue of $1.18 billion and a net income of $102.28 million, while its EBITDA stands at $216.94 million. The substantial gap between revenue and net income, where net income represents approximately 8.6% of total revenue, reveals a cost structure where operating expenses, including cost of goods sold and general administrative costs, consume a significant portion of top-line growth before reaching the bottom line. TaskUs generated free cash flow of $71.94 million, which indicates a positive ability to convert earnings into cash, providing the financial flexibility to fund operations, service debt, or pursue strategic initiatives without relying solely on external financing. The company's profitability is characterized by a gross margin of 39.9%, an operating margin of 12.0%, and a profit margin of 8.6%, suggesting that while the service model retains nearly 40% of revenue after direct costs, significant overheads reduce the final profit retained by shareholders. Regarding liquidity and leverage, the company holds $211.68 million in cash against total debt of $297.73 million, resulting in a debt-to-equity ratio of 49.62% which suggests a moderately leveraged balance sheet where debt levels are nearly half the equity base. The current ratio is reported at 3.12, indicating a robust short-term liquidity position where current assets are more than three times current liabilities, ensuring the ability to meet short-term obligations comfortably. Furthermore, the return on equity is 18.6% and the return on assets is 9.7%, metrics that reveal management's effectiveness in utilizing shareholder capital and total assets to generate returns, with equity returns nearly double those of assets due to the leverage applied.

关于TaskUs, Inc.
TaskUs, Inc. provides outsourced digital services for companies in Philippines, the United States, India, and internationally. The company offers digital customer experience that consists of omni-channel customer care services primarily delivered through non-voice digital channels; and other solutions, including learning experience, new product or market launches, and sales and customer acquisition solutions. It also provides trust and safety solutions, such as monitoring, reviewing and managing user and advertiser-generated content on online platforms to ensure it complies with community guidelines, legal regulations, platform specific policies, risk management, compliance, identity management and fraud; and artificial intelligence (AI) solutions that consist of data labeling, annotation, context relevance, and transcription services for training and tuning machine learning algorithms that enables to develop AI systems. It serves clients in various industry segments comprising social media, e-commerce, gaming, streaming media, food delivery and ride sharing, technology, financial services, and healthcare. The company was formerly known as TU TopCo, Inc. and changed its name to TaskUs, Inc. in December 2020. TaskUs, Inc. was founded in 2008 and is headquartered in New Braunfels, Texas.
